After 6 years of planning, I've finally done it!
I am extremely happy with how surgery went. We started at 7am and I was home in bed by 1045am.
Feeling a lot of discomfort and it's 4am the next day and I just can't sleep. My husband has been the best caretaker. He has helped me with my meds, brought me food (BRAT diet) and helping me in the bathroom. No nausea at all and I've walked around the house a bit. Pain is about a 6, just feeling pressure and motion in my arms are minimal.
I haven't taken a real peek at the "girls" but I am so pleased with what I have seen!
Height: 5'9
Weight: 142
Pre Op bra size: 34a
Implant and CC's: Sientra 415cc

Day 3 - Post op
Today is day 3 after having a BA. I was able to shower but felt nauseous. Hubby was quick to grab my Zofran and that definitely made things better.
I finally took a peek at how my new self is healing. I know everything is swollen still, but I like where things are headed. My pain is just near the incision sights now, but has been managed with Tylenol and gabapentin. I was able to lift my arms above my head and even put my hair up. I'd say that's a win!
